Sistema de control de revisiones (rcs)

Definición: ¿Qué significa Sistema de control de revisiones (RCS)?

Un sistema de control de revisiones (RCS) es una aplicación capaz de almacenar, registrar, identificar, fusionar o identificar información relacionada con la revisión de software, documentación de la aplicación, documentos o formularios. La mayoría de los sistemas de control de revisiones almacenan esta información con la ayuda de una utilidad diferencial para documentos.

Un sistema de control de revisiones es una herramienta esencial para una organización con tareas o proyectos de múltiples desarrolladores, ya que es capaz de identificar problemas y errores y de recuperar una versión de trabajo anterior de una aplicación o documento cuando sea necesario.

Un sistema de control de revisiones también se conoce como sistema de control de versiones.

Techinfo explica el sistema de control de revisiones (RCS)

La mayoría de los sistemas de control de revisiones se ejecutan como aplicaciones independientes independientes. Hay dos tipos de sistemas de control de revisiones: centralizados y descentralizados. Algunas aplicaciones, como hojas de cálculo y procesadores de texto, tienen mecanismos de control de revisión integrados. Los diseñadores y desarrolladores a veces utilizan el control de revisión para mantener la documentación junto con los archivos de configuración para sus desarrollos. Es posible obtener documentación y productos de alta calidad con el uso adecuado de los sistemas de control de revisiones.

Un sistema de control de revisiones tiene las siguientes características:

  • Para todos los documentos y tipos de documentos, el historial actualizado puede estar disponible.
  • Es un sistema simple y no requiere otros sistemas de repositorio.
  • Por cada documento mantenido, se pueden realizar registros de entrada y salida.
  • Tiene la capacidad de recuperar y volver a una versión anterior del documento. Esto es extremadamente útil en caso de eliminaciones accidentales.
  • De manera simplificada, las características secundarias y los errores se pueden identificar y corregir utilizando el sistema. La resolución de problemas también se simplifica.
  • Su sistema de etiquetas ayuda a diferenciar entre versiones alfa, beta o de lanzamiento para diferentes documentos o aplicaciones.
  • La colaboración se vuelve más fácil en un proyecto de desarrollo de aplicaciones de varias personas.